xStatus NetworkServices NTP Status
Returns the status of the endpoints synchronizing with the NTP server.
Discarded: The NTP result has been discarded.
Synced: The system is in sync with the NTP server.
NotSynced: The system is not in sync with the NTP server.
Unknown: The state of the synchronization is unknown.
Off: No synchronization with the NTP server.
Requires user role: ADMIN, USER
Value space of the result returned:
Discarded/Synced/NotSynced/Unknown/Off
Example:
xStatus NetworkServices NTP Status
*s NetworkServices NTP Status: Synced
** end

Peripherals status
xStatus Peripherals ConnectedDevice [n] HardwareInfo
Shows hardware information about connected device.
Requires user role: ADMIN, INTEGRATOR, USER, ROOMCONTROL
Value space of the result returned:
String
Example:
xStatus Peripherals ConnectedDevice 1007 HardwareInfo
*s Peripherals ConnectedDevice 1007 HardwareInfo: "1122330-0"
** end
xStatus Peripherals ConnectedDevice [n] ID
Shows the MAC-address of the connected device.
Requires user role: ADMIN, INTEGRATOR, USER, ROOMCONTROL
Value space of the result returned:
String
Example:
xStatus Peripherals ConnectedDevice 1007 ID
*s Peripherals ConnectedDevice 1007 ID: "00:10:20:20:be:21"
** end
xStatus Peripherals ConnectedDevice [n] Name
Shows the product name of connected device.
Requires user role: ADMIN, INTEGRATOR, USER, ROOMCONTROL
Value space of the result returned:
String
Example:
xStatus Peripherals ConnectedDevice 1007 Name
*s Peripherals ConnectedDevice 1007 Name: "Cisco TelePresence Touch"
** end
